Overview

Provides a foundation of knowledge that is common to both ProLiant ML/DL Server and HP BladeSystem products. Describes service information resources and how to access them and provides an overview of the Systems Insight Manager and HP Troubleshooting methods. Assists in preparation for both the Accredited Platform Specialist (APS) certification exams; ProLiant ML/DL servers and the HP BladeSystem.

The APS is no longer a required pre-requisite for AIS accreditation. The 37948 – Service Fundamentals can be used as a text-based reference for those who will pursue only an AIS accreditation. Service Fundamentals training focuses on those methods, practices, and service considerations that are common to servicing either ProLiant ML/DL or HP BladeSystem products. The student will become familiar with the service considerations for HP servers as a foundation for the diagnostic process.

Objectives

  • Explain how the HP ProLiant Server family is organized into lines and series
  • Obtain and use HP Information resources needed to support ProLiant server products
  • Explan how HP Insight Management Agents integrate with other features to facilitate the management of ProLiant Servers
  • Describe HP management applications and platforms for ProLiant servers
  • Explain the six-step HP troubleshooting methodology
  • Identify and locate basic components of the ProLiant servers
  • Locate service information and differenct toolset for servicing legacy equipment

Pre-Requisites

  • ProLiant Server Basics, course 209, is required preparation in server technology.
  • HP ProLiant Family, course 205, is required preparation in ProLiant family products.
